Senior Software Engineer (London)
Opencoreos
Posted: November 25, 2025
Interested in this position?
Create a free account to apply with AI-powered matching
Quick Summary
We're building a mission-critical, AI-native platform for a regulated institution, utilizing a multi-region CockroachDB/YugabyteDB, Kafka, and Protobuf-based architecture.
Required Skills
Job Description
About OpenCoreOS
• We're building the first open-source "Thin Ledger", designed to replace legacy core systems with a Golang-based, Protobuf-defined, event-driven platform powered by Kafka, Redis, and multi-region CockroachDB/YugabyteDB.
• Our platform is AI-native from the ground up: autonomous SRE agents, AI-generated runbooks, and everything-as-code—from policies to infrastructure definitions.
• We're mission-critical by default, targeting five-nines uptime and multi-region failover for regulated institutions.
• We work openly and fast, and colocate in Huckletree, Liverpool St, London for in-person collaboration, supported by async-friendly workflows.
What You Will Work On
• Ledger Engine: Deterministic, event-sourced transaction engine.
• Interest & Pricing Engine: High-precision financial calculations.
• Reconciliation Engine: Invariants, controls, and cross-ledger consistency.
• Operational Data Store (ODS): Real-time operational data plane.
• Scalability Layer: Concurrency, throughput, partitioning, and replication.
• AI-Native Dev Experience: MCP servers, agent workflows, and automated runbooks.
Core Responsibilities
• Build early MVPs for Tier-1 banks.
• Architect distributed systems with Go, Kafka, and distributed SQL DBs.
• Own systems across the full SDLC (coding, testing, DevOps, infra, product shaping).
• Implement advanced CI/CD and testing automation.
Essential Skills
• Language: Go
• Kafka / Event-driven systems
• Distributed systems, concurrency, and invariants
• GitOps
• Strong debugging, testing, and production ownership
• AI-Native Workflow: LLMs required daily
Nice-to-Haves
• Fintech/Banking experience
• Oncall / High-availability systems experience
• Multi-region systems exposure
Benefits Overview:
• 4 Weeks of PTO
• Medical & Dental Insurance
• Eligible for Sign on Bonus
• Pension
• Paid National Holidays
• Annual Bonus Eligibility
Why join us?
• Massive impact: Transform how T1 banks handle billions of transactions daily—on a truly open platform.
• High-caliber team: Join a small team of exceptional engineers who value both speed and stability.
• AI-native workspace: Experience an AI-first environment with LLMs integrated into every tool.